Legal and Ethical Concerns
One aspect often overlooked in the discussion about drones is the legal implications of operating these devices within urban environments. The discovery of this abandoned drone brings to light questions about privacy and regulation. In New York City, the operation of drones is closely monitored and subject to strict guidelines to ensure safety and protect privacy. The presence of an unattended drone could imply unauthorized activity, leading to important ethical considerations.
